Nevado de Toluca: The High-Altitude Hike

The highlight of the tour is the guided hike around the Sun and Moon Lagoons, located within the crater of Nevado de Toluca. The hike lasts about 2 hours and involves walking at an altitude of 4,680 meters, which can be a challenge for some. The lagoons are striking—deep blue waters against a backdrop of rugged volcanic terrain—and offer fantastic photo opportunities.

A reviewer mentioned that, despite some rain during the ascent, they still enjoyed the views, highlighting the resilience and flexibility needed for mountain excursions. The admission to the lagoons is included, removing one potential hassle, and the guide’s knowledge enhances the experience by pointing out key features and local lore.

Cultural Highlights in Toluca

After the outdoor adventure, the tour shifts focus to Toluca’s historic city center. You’ll visit the Catedral de Toluca, an impressive structure with a long history, and stroll around the Alameda Central, a lovely park area where locals gather.

Another major stop is the Cosmovitral Botanical Garden, famous for its stained glass artwork covering the main building—a beautiful fusion of art and nature. The admission is included, and many travelers find it a captivating place to relax and take photos.

The guided city tour lasts about 2 hours, giving you time to absorb Toluca’s charm, browse local shops, or simply soak in the lively atmosphere. One reviewer described Toluca as “pitoresca” (picturesque) and the Nevado as “very beautiful,” reinforcing the appeal of these sights.
